About this Course

Don't have a business background but want to understand how people and systems of an organisation interact with the world and each other? Work through this course and equip yourself with the knowledge you need to make sense of the external influences that affect the business in its environment, including economic, legal, social and technological factors. Understanding a Business and its environment is important in shaping the role of key business functions. This carefully considered assessment of the business’s environment can contribute to the efficient, effective and ethical management and development of an organisation. This course is especially beneficial if you want to: Understand the purpose and types of businesses Delve deeper into the structure and key functions of a business, including corporate governance Launch your own business and need an understanding of leadership, management and people issues including motivation Prepare for the ACCA’s exam in Business and Technology (BT). Please note this course and the exam was previously named ‘Accountant in Business’. There is no prior knowledge required. Start learning today and accelerate your business and finance acumen.
